Is 2 cores enough for Kali Linux?

Should be very possible to install Kali Linux on a dual core CPU. The docs on the Kali website indicate that the minimum requirements for installation are below: A minimum of 20 GB disk space for the Kali Linux install. RAM for i386 and amd64 architectures, minimum: 1GB, recommended: 2GB or more.

Is 32gb enough for Kali Linux?

The Kali Linux installation guide says it requires 10 GB. If you install every Kali Linux package, it would take an extra 15 GB. It looks like 25 GB is a reasonable amount for the system, plus a bit for personal files, so you might go for 30 or 40 GB.

How much RAM is required for kali linux in virtualbox?

1GB of RAM (2GB Recommend), 20GB of free space. How much hard drive space is required for a Kali Linux VM? A full installation of Kali Linux consumes ~12GB of hard drive space. Kali Lite installed without additional tools consumes just under 3.2GB of hard drive space.

Which is faster lubuntu or Xubuntu?

Lubuntu is the faster, lighter operating system. Xubuntu requires a minimum RAM of 512 MB while Lubuntu can extend down to 224 MB of RAM to function. Installation requires 256 MB of RAM on Xubuntu while Lubuntu only requires 160 MB.

What is the difference between Ubuntu and Lubuntu?

Despite sharing the same base, Ubuntu and Lubuntu are two different operating systems, each with its own distinct look and feel. Lubuntu is a lightweight operating system that runs great on less powerful hardware, while Ubuntu is known for constantly pushing the Linux desktop in new, interesting directions.
